"2.The option to have the 4 gauge cluster pack without the RS package."
The Gauge Package has nothing to do with Rally Sport package. It is standard on 2LT and 2SS ONLY. I wish the gauges were standard on 1SS and 2SS (performance models) and optional on all other trim levels.
